A股11月开门红
财联社· 2025-11-03 07:14
Market Overview - The A-share market experienced a rebound today, with all three major indices turning positive. The Shanghai and Shenzhen markets had a total trading volume of 2.11 trillion, a decrease of 210.7 billion compared to the previous trading day [1][7]. - The market saw rapid rotation of hotspots, with over 3,500 stocks rising. The photovoltaic sector was notably active, with companies like Arctech rising over 12% [1]. Sector Performance - The thorium-based molten salt concept stocks performed strongly, with Baose shares and Hailu Heavy Industry hitting the daily limit [1]. - AI application stocks were also active, with Jishi Media and 37 Interactive Entertainment reaching the daily limit [1]. - The coal sector showed renewed strength, with Antai Group achieving 7 limit-ups in 13 days [1]. - The Hainan Free Trade Zone sector continued its strong performance, with multiple stocks like Ronu Mountain hitting the daily limit [1]. - Storage chip concept stocks saw a recovery, with Purun shares rising over 14% [1]. - In contrast, the battery sector showed weakness, with Haike New Energy experiencing a significant drop [1][2]. Index Performance - As of the market close, the Shanghai Composite Index rose by 0.55%, the Shenzhen Component Index increased by 0.19%, and the ChiNext Index gained 0.29% [3][4].
